"Has anyone ever told you that you look just like Q from James Bond?"
I resisted the urge to roll my eyes. I'd heard this about a million times over the last five years or so, since Ben Whishaw first played Q in Skyfall. I couldn't deny it. I did look quite a lot like him - I had glasses and dark unruly hair that never sat flat no matter what I did with it - and as nerdy as it sounds, I was kind of chuffed that my name could be shortened to Q...
I would never describe myself as handsome though - not like Ben Whishaw, who I thought was absolutely stunning. I looked up and sucked in a sharp breath. It was the tall, dark, exotic-looking dancer that I'd been crushing on for weeks. I was quite sure he was called Thai... And he was speaking to me! Was he actually hitting on me? Nah… probably not - but he thought I looked like Q! For once it wasn't annoying me to be compared to a super-geek.
I grinned at him. The music was pumping, the beat vibrating through my body and I was feeling really kind of mellow. I f***ing loved coming to this nightclub and tonight was no exception. Raising my voice so I could be heard over the music, I replied, "Uh, yeah - I've heard that once or twice."
He chuckled, his deep, almost musical laugh making my insides feel a little mushy. "And are you a mad, gadget-creating genius on the quiet - or do your talents lie elsewhere?" He shouted.
Oh, my God - he really was flirting with me! Flirting! With me! Where were all my mates to witness this amazing event?
Oh, yes - Franz was snogging the face off his boyfriend in the foyer - and all the others were no doubt in the bathrooms getting their rocks off with unsuspecting punters...
"I'm more your artistic type." I said back as loudly as I could. I might be studying physics but I really did love to draw and paint. I had about twenty sketches of him that I'd done from memory. Looking into those incredible eyes now, though, with his super long and curly eyelashes - it was more than obvious that I hadn't done him justice. I'd have to have another go when I got home...
